Output 621e582eb9afbe144da1eedfff2768fc8365c150a466d739467e427ab41d9d4b:0

value
31000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d9d7de59dbe6d065527c23944efe6e88de72a52 OP_EQUAL
address
3Qp1YoEQRwBbwLXfcu35vjAofk3MN7vgv5
transaction
621e582eb9afbe144da1eedfff2768fc8365c150a466d739467e427ab41d9d4b
spent
true